Bmw track app review

Wrote a longer tread and then it crashed so shorter version.

M235i with pro nav.
Bmw apps came as standard
iphone connected via normal charging cable.
Track app loaded via connected drive.

Press record on idrive.
Logs lots of date, including:

Throttle %
Brake %
G force
Steering angle
Speed
GPS position

App then overlays details on top of map and let's you "play" through your lap.
If you set a start position (and actually drive in a loop) it will record each "lap" seperately and give you comparative lap times etc.

Few screen shots from a quick play:







All in all great free app and will be perfect for track days

Interesting - Toyota just released an even more comprehensive data logging tool for the FR-S/GT86, but you need to download the data to Gran Tourismo 6 on a PS3 - then you can run your real life lap virtually and see a full set of MOTEC-like data. Of course at present this logging only works when driving a few tracks in Japan...
